China Drafts a Revised List of 8203 Existing Cosmetic Ingredients (IECIC 2014)

On May 30, 2014, CFDA opened for the second phase of public consultation on the Inventory of Existing Cosmetic Ingredients in China (IECIC 2014). The revised list includes 8203 cosmetic ingredients that have already been used in approved cosmetic products in China compared to the initial consolidated list of 8641 in January this year. The revision also excluded 3382 ingredients to the list.

This public consultation aims to further verify the existing ingredients used in cosmetics and to standardize the management of new cosmetic ingredients in China. The main points are summarized as below:

(1)   Ingredients included in the IECIC 2014

The revised list of 8203 is a collection of cosmetic ingredients that have been used including restricted substances, restricted preservatives, restricted sunscreen agents, restricted coloring agents and hair colorants that are allowed to be used temporarily. In addition, remarks regarding certain issues are also included such as the definition of plant material and the usage of special purpose ingredients. 

(2)   Ingredients temporarily excluded in the IECIC 2014

3383 ingredients are found to be partially problematic, attributable to one of the following five reasons:

  • Lack of relevant documents such as the Filling Records of Domestic Non-special-purpose Cosmetics;
  • Name of the ingredient cannot be identified
  • Ingredient with potential safety risk
  • Ingredient that violates laws in China such as usage of endangered species as main ingredients
  • Ingredient that requires further verification

(3)   Purpose of the List

The List serves as the main reference for verification of new cosmetic ingredients only, not the list of approved cosmetic ingredients in China.

(4)   Usage of the List

It needs to be noted that the CFDA has not conducted any risk assessments of the ingredients listed in the IECIC, therefore, manufacturers have to undertake the responsibility of product safety by selecting ingredients that comply with relevant regulations and standards and also by conducting their own risk assessments.
